What is the easiest way to enable a powerpoint presentation to show multiple
page pdf files that have been imported into a presentation as an object.
The normal view show the pdf file and when I click on it acrobat opens up
and I can show both pages. However, when playing the full screen slide show
the double click on the document does not open up acrobat. I guess I could
separate the pdf into separate pages and incorporate each page into a slide.
Hopefully, there is an easier way to accomplish this without separating out
all the documents.
Don't insert as object ... simply create a link to the PDF and it should work
as you want it to from a PPT slide show.
